Throughout the first semester, our Lighthouse Team has led the way in spreading kindness across our campus. With thoughtful planning and servant hearts, they focused on uplifting our faculty and staff in meaningful ways. From creating snack and drink stations to brighten busy days, to sharing words of encouragement that lifted spirits, their efforts made a lasting impact. They also took time to recognize and celebrate the many accomplishments happening throughout our school, reminding us all that every success—big or small—matters.
These acts of kindness are deeply connected to the leadership habits our students are learning through the Leader in Me program. As our Pandas practice being proactive, thinking win-win, and valuing others, kindness naturally becomes part of who they are. It is no longer just something we encourage—it is something our students live out daily.
